## Authentication

FormulaCage evaluates user-supplied formulas inside an isolated interpreter with no network or filesystem access. The sandbox host itself, however, must authenticate to our internal PolicyVault service to fetch allowlisted function definitions at startup. Reviewers can reproduce the startup handshake locally against the staging PolicyVault. The staging key is below.

API key for hahag-kafof: vxb3-kck

# Break-Glass: Catalog Cache Invalidation

Scope: the Pinrow product catalog at Veldstone Retail. If stale prices persist after a purge and the Hollowmere invalidation queue is wedged, use break-glass to flush the edge tier directly. Contractors: get verbal sign-off from the catalog lead first. Steps: open the Hollowmere admin shell, select emergency-flush, confirm the tenant, and run it once — repeated flushes thrash the origin. Access is logged and expires after 20 minutes. Unseal the admin shell with the passphrase below.

recovery phrase for kahop-tajog: istix-casvan

Handover note — Marek to Ilse

Welcome aboard, Ilse. The main live item is the term sheet from Quollmere Partners for the Bryntal expansion. It's broadly sensible, but push back on the exclusivity clause — Davan and I both flagged it. Legal review is booked for next Thursday; you'll want to sit in. Everything else can wait a fortnight. The context you'll need is summarised in the confidential note below.

internal memo for kaguf-yajog: Headcount on the Druath team goes from 30 to 70 by the end of November. Gross margin on Druath came in at 56 percent against a plan of 28 percent.

## Provenance: Static-Analysis Baseline

The baseline file for the Corvasse analyzer is regenerated only on tagged releases, never on feature branches. Maintainers should treat any drift between the committed baseline and a fresh scan as a provenance failure, not noise. Each regeneration is tied to the exact pipeline run recorded by the token below.

session token of tajog-fahaf = htk21_4ae55819f45410afcb307